They can be low-quality

Google PageRank is not the only ranking factor that search engines consider when determining a website’s ranking, so it’s crucial to understand the role that no-follow and follow links play in your SEO climb to the top. A good rule of thumb is to identify relevant links to your brand, which should ideally lead to good SEO. The more people trust your brand, the more positive dividends you’ll see in your SEO ranking.

Generally speaking, low-quality links are those that originate from sites that have poor quality content, such as blogs that cover a broad range of topics. They’re also not authoritative or relevant, and they don’t follow the best link-quality guidelines. In addition, low-quality links can be created on request and can affect your website’s ranking by being flagged as a manipulative linking scheme by search engines. Luckily, webmasters can control their outgoing links and can avoid acquiring them by requesting links or building them themselves.

The problem with low-quality backlinks is that they usually come from irrelevant and spammy sites. These sites don’t offer anything to the user, and the links don’t add any value to your site. While it is possible to build high-quality backlinks, it’s important to note that Google’s algorithm is becoming increasingly adept at detecting such spammy backlinks. Having too many backlinks from low-quality sites will damage your rankings and reputation.

They can be spammy

Even if you haven’t noticed it yet, backlinks can be spammy. While a single spammy link won’t hurt your SEO, a large number of spammy backlinks can. If your traffic changes and you notice a spike in spam, don’t ignore the issue – Google will pick up on it quickly. Moreover, you can disavow spammy backlinks if you feel that they hurt your website’s reputation.

Although you might be tempted to purchase links, remember that they have a negative effect on your site. The process of acquiring backlinks is not an overnight task. Building high-quality backlinks from high-authority sites takes time. Don’t try to cheat the system by buying links. Backlinks are important but they shouldn’t be spammy. Ideally, you should build them naturally, with a focus on quality.

Besides spammy backlinks, they are also unnatural. For example, spamming newswires and guest posting on low-authority sites will cause your website to be deindexed and devalued. When building links, try to focus on high-authority niche-related websites and branded anchor texts. Don’t waste your time focusing on exact-match anchor texts. Consistent efforts will eventually yield positive results.
